Komputer: Difference between revisions

No edit summary
Line 20: Line 20:
Perangkat lunak adalah program yang berisi instruksi untuk menjalankan perangkat keras. Perangkat lunak dibagi menjadi dua kategori utama:
Perangkat lunak adalah program yang berisi instruksi untuk menjalankan perangkat keras. Perangkat lunak dibagi menjadi dua kategori utama:


# '''Sistem Operasi:''' Perangkat lunak sistem yang bertugas mengontrol perangkat keras, mengatur sumber daya, dan menjadi penghubung antara pengguna dan perangkat keras. Contoh sistem operasi meliputi Microsoft Windows, Linux, dan macOS,-. Sistem operasi memiliki komponen penting seperti mekanisme ''boot'', kernel, ''command interpreter'' (shell), dan pustaka-pustaka.
# '''[[Sistem Operasi]]:''' Perangkat lunak sistem yang bertugas mengontrol perangkat keras, mengatur sumber daya, dan menjadi penghubung antara pengguna dan perangkat keras. Contoh sistem operasi meliputi Microsoft Windows, Linux, dan macOS. Sistem operasi memiliki komponen penting seperti mekanisme ''boot'', kernel, ''command interpreter'' (shell), dan pustaka-pustaka.
# '''Program Aplikasi:''' Perangkat lunak yang dirancang untuk membantu pengguna menyelesaikan tugas spesifik, seperti aplikasi perkantoran (pengolah kata dan angka), aplikasi grafis, dan aplikasi multimedia,-.
# '''[[Program Aplikasi]]:''' Perangkat lunak yang dirancang untuk membantu pengguna menyelesaikan tugas spesifik, seperti aplikasi perkantoran (pengolah kata dan angka), aplikasi grafis, dan aplikasi multimedia,-.


Selain itu, terdapat '''BIOS''' (''Basic Input Output System''), yaitu perangkat lunak yang dipasang pada chip komputer (firmware) untuk mengatur operasi dasar perangkat keras saat komputer pertama kali dinyalakan (booting).
Selain itu, terdapat [[BIOS|'''BIOS''' (''Basic Input Output System'')]], yaitu perangkat lunak yang dipasang pada chip komputer (firmware) untuk mengatur operasi dasar perangkat keras saat komputer pertama kali dinyalakan (booting).


=== Pengguna (''Brainware'') ===
=== Pengguna (''Brainware'') ===